Director of Sales Salary in Orlando, Florida: Complete Guide (2026)
The median Director of Sales salary in Orlando, FL is $161,000 per year as of Q1 2026. This figure represents the midpoint of all reported compensation for this role in the OrlandoβFL metropolitan area, based on data from the Bureau of Labor Statistics Occupational Employment Statistics, H-1B visa disclosures from the Department of Labor, and O*NET occupational data.
Salary range for Director of Sales in Orlando
Entry-level Director of Saless in Orlando with 0β2 years of experience typically earn between $120,000 and $161,000 annually. Mid-career professionals with 3β7 years command $161,000 to $214,000, while senior-level practitioners with 8+ years of experience regularly earn $214,000 to $284,000 or more.
Cost of living in Orlando for Director of Saless
Orlando has a cost of living index of 100 compared to the US national average of 100. Living costs in Orlando are close to the national average. Crucially, Florida has no state income tax β giving Orlando-based Director of Saless an immediate 3β5% take-home pay advantage over workers in states like California (9.3%) or New York (6.85%).
